Unfortunately, it is not possible now. The only thing you can do is to rerun Quast with the same command on the same output folder. In this case, some already computed results (e.g. contig alignments) will be reused while some others will be recomputed. So, in summary, it will be faster than running Quast from scratch but still would take non-trivial time.
At the same time, we are aware of this issue (and this related one) and hope to make a better workaround soon.
